听力原文: Body language, with the technical name non-verbal communication, does not involve tile use of words, NVC for short.
When someone is saying something with which he agrees, the average European will smile and nod approval. On the other hand, if you disagree, you may frown and shake your head. Incidentally, I referred a moment ago to "the average European", because body language is very much tied to culture, and in order not to misunderstand, or not to be misunderstood, you must appreciate this. A smiling Chinese, for instance, may not be approving but acutely embarrassed.
Quite a lot of work is now being done on the subject of NVC, which is obviously important, for instance, to managers, who have to deal every day with their staff, and have to understand what other people are feeling ff they are to create good working conditions. Body language, or NVC signals, are sometimes categorized into five kinds: (1) body and facial gestures; (2) eye contact; (3) body contact or proximity; (4) clothing and physical appearance; and (5) the quality of speech. In some cultures—and I am sure this is a cultural feature and not an individual one—it is quite normal for people to stand close together, or to more or less thrust their face into yours when they are talking to you. In other cultures this is disliked; Americans, for instance, talk about invasion of their space.
